White & Case advises consortium of banks on US financing for LNG-to-power project in the Dominican Republic
White & Case LLP has advised Citibank, N.A. and JPMorgan Chase Bank, N.A. as joint lead arrangers, joint bookrunners, and joint structuring agents, as well as IDB Invest, Corporación Andina de Fomento, and the other mandated lead arrangers and senior lenders, on the US$902.3 million senior secured limited recourse project financing for the Manzanillo LNG-to-power project in the Dominican Republic.

Golar LNG orders fourth FLNG unit for 2029 delivery
Golar LNG Ltd has executed an EPC agreement with CIMC Raffles for its fourth floating LNG (FLNG) and second MKII design FLNG production vessel.
